Sandals Officially Opens in Barbados

By: Caribbean Journal Staff - February 2, 2015

Above: the new Sandals Barbados

By the Caribbean Journal staff

Sandals has welcomed its first guests in Barbados following a wide-ranging $65 million renovation project.

The project, at the site of the former Couples Barbados, is located in Christ Church on the island’s South Coast.

sbrestaurant

 

Above: the Bayside restaurant

“We are absolutely thrilled to be here in Barbados, one of the leading destinations in the world,” said General Manager Josef Zellner. “Sandals and Barbados are a perfect fit which visitors will enjoy for many years to come. This dream has been a long time coming and we are happy to finally be here.”

sbsuite

Above: a suite at Sandals Barbados

The Dover-area property has 10 restaurants including an Indian restaurant, a first for the brand, called the Bombay Club.

The 280-room property, which includes Sandals River Suites, employs more than 600 people.

Sandals now has 15 branded properties across the region.
